Pop babe Tulisa has reportedly been targeted by trolls which said that they wish she killed herself, after news broke that her pals feared the singer would commit suicide following drug allegations against her.
Several tweets were posted which expressed disappointment that the 25-year old former X Factor judge had not managed to take her own life, the Daily Express reported.
Jonathan Shalit, her manager had admitted that he was worried that the singer-songwriter would commit suicide after she came across the social media lash back, and had arranged for surveillance at her house for two consecutive nights "to make sure she did not do anything stupid".
Tulisa was arrested after allegedly boasting that she could get 800 pounds of cocaine for an undercover reporter and she was on bail until late October for allegedly fixing the sale.
